Relying on a reliable Marine Biomolecule Production team, CD BioGlyco provides our clients with high-yield Marine Glycoside Production Services. 17α-Hydroxy impatienside is a triterpene glycoside isolated from sea cucumber. It has a wide range of biological activities such as antimicrobial activity and cytotoxicity. Extraction and Isolation

  • Organic solvent extraction: Our researchers chop and grind the dried sea cucumber and extract it through the steps of ethanol reflux, evaporation under reduced pressure, and n-BuOH separation.
  • For the crude product obtained from the isolation, our lab uses column chromatography for further purification. Our researchers have proven operational experience with separations. By changing the buffer, elution gradient, and column packing to separate as many components as possible to obtain a high purity of the target product.

Publication

Technology: Two-dimensional NMR (2D NMR)

Journal: Marine Drugs

Published: 2011

IF: 5.4

Results: In this study, the researchers summarized a series of bioactive substances extracted from sea cucumber such as triterpene glycosides (saponins), glycosaminoglycans (GAGs), polysaccharides sulfate, sterols (glycosides and sulfates), glycoproteins, and so on. Combining chemical and chromatographic techniques, the researchers obtained several secondary metabolites, i.e. triterpene glycosides. Their structures were determined by NMR and other spectroscopic identifications. Moreover, extensive experiments have shown that 17α-hydroxy impatienside A has potential antimicrobial potential.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the carbohydrate chain of a triterpene glycoside usually composed of?

The carbohydrate chains of triterpene glycosides usually contain xylose, glucose, quinovose, 3-O-methylglucose, and in rare cases 3-O-methylxylose, 3-O-methylglucuronide, 3-O-methylquinose, and 6-O-acetylglucose.

What is glycoside?

Glycoside is a sugar-containing derivative in which a monosaccharide or oligosaccharide is bound to another non-sugar compound or functional group via a glucosidic bond, i.e., a class of compounds formed by the combination of a glycone with a genin.
